Who we are

The Molecular Extraction Pipeline (MEP), is part of UNSW Biospecimen Services. MEP provides high‑quality, reproducible DNA and RNA extraction services using manual extraction workflows and automated magnetic‑bead platforms (KingFisher systems). Automated extraction reduces hands‑on time, minimises batch‑to‑batch variation, and supports both small and large‑scale projects.

We are located at the Lowy Cancer Centre and in the Integrated Acute Services Building (IASB) that is situated alongside Randwick's new Prince of Wales Hospital Acute Services Building.

Our workflows are optimised for consistency, scalability, and compatibility with downstream applications including qPCR, ddPCR, short‑read next-generation sequencing (NGS), and long‑read sequencing technologies.

Our services

Automated Extraction Services

Our laboratory delivers high-throughput, fully automated nucleic acid extraction using Thermo Scientific KingFisher™ Apex and Duo Prime systems.

We provide scalable, contamination controlled workflows validated across diverse sample types, producing high-yield, high-purity RNA and DNA suitable for qPCR, NGS, sequencing, and diagnostics with consistent, reproducible results.

Manual Extraction Services

For projects under 50 samples, we provide carefully controlled manual extractions using premium commercial kits. Workflows include silica column and magnetic bead–based methods, selected per sample type and application. This approach enables customization, careful handling, and high-quality RNA and DNA for demanding downstream analyses.

Quality  Control, Data analysis & Reporting  

Every extraction includes comprehensive quality control and professional reporting to ensure transparency and reliability. We provide validated concentration measurements, spectrophotometric purity assessment (A260/280, A260/230), and detailed sample-level QC reports. Secure electronic data delivery supports confident decision-making for qPCR, NGS, sequencing, library preparation, and molecular diagnostics.

Advanced QC & Workflow Optimization Services

We offer optional advanced services including pilot method comparison for kit validation, re-extraction or clean-up to improve yield and purity, RNA and DNA integrity analysis (RIN/DIN), and professional sample sortation and labeling. These services ensure optimized workflows, application-ready nucleic acids, and reliable, decision-grade data.

Instruments

  • The Thermo Scientific KingFisher™ Apex is a high-throughput automated magnetic particle processor engineered for large-scale nucleic acid extraction. It delivers exceptional reproducibility and minimizes human intervention, significantly reducing variability and cross-contamination risk. Its advanced automation capabilities allow standardized processing across large batches, ensuring consistent yield and purity. This platform is particularly valuable for projects requiring scalability, efficiency, and strict quality compliance.

  • The KingFisher™ Duo Prime offers flexible, lower-throughput automation without compromising extraction performance. It is ideal for smaller studies, pilot runs, method optimization, and specialized sample types. By combining automation with adaptability, the Duo Prime ensures consistent magnetic bead–based purification while maintaining rapid turnaround times and high-quality nucleic acid recovery.

  • TapeStation system provides automated electrophoretic analysis for nucleic acid quality assessment. It enables accurate determination of RNA Integrity Number (RIN) and DNA Integrity Number (DIN), offering critical insight into sample fragmentation and suitability for downstream applications such as next-generation sequencing and transcriptomic analysis. By integrating integrity assessment into our workflow, we help ensure that only high-quality nucleic acids proceed to advanced molecular applications.

  • A microvolume spectrophotometer designed for rapid and precise nucleic acid quantification and purity assessment. It measures concentration and calculates A260/280 and A260/230 ratios to evaluate potential protein, salt, or reagent contamination. This immediate, reliable quantification step allows us to validate extraction efficiency and confirm that samples meet purity thresholds required for sensitive molecular techniques.
